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ical nightly rate for boarding a dog in Douglas, Michigan?

In Douglas, you can expect to pay between $40 and $60 per night for standard dog boarding. Luxury suites or facilities offering extra playtime and webcam access may charge up to $85. It's always a good idea to ask Douglas kennels about multi-pet or extended-stay discounts.

What unique amenities do Douglas boarding facilities offer for my pet's comfort?

Many Douglas kennels take advantage of our local setting with features like climate-controlled indoor/outdoor runs and spacious play yards. Some even offer 'pupdates' with photos from your pet's day or special treat times. Given Douglas's proximity to Lake Michigan, several facilities also have shaded outdoor areas to keep pets cool on warmer days.

What specific items should I pack for my pet's stay at a Douglas boarding facility?

You should bring your pet's regular food to prevent stomach upset, any required medications with clear instructions, and their current vaccination records. While Douglas facilities provide the essentials, a familiar blanket or t-shirt with your scent can greatly ease your pet's transition while you're away enjoying Saugatuck-Douglas.

How far in advance should I book my pet's boarding reservation in Douglas?

For standard travel, booking a few weeks in advance is usually sufficient. However, due to the high volume of summer tourists and holiday travelers in the Saugatuck-Douglas area, it is highly recommended to book several months ahead for peak seasons like summer and major holidays to ensure you get a spot.

What are the vaccination requirements for boarding a pet in Douglas?

Virtually all reputable boarding facilities in Douglas require proof of current vaccinations for Rabies, DHPP (for dogs), FVRCP (for cats),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some may also request a negative fecal test. Be sure to have your vet records sent or bring them with you to your appointment.
